§ 45.1-161.130. Blasting cables.

Blasting cables shall be:

1. Well insulated and as long as may be necessary to permit the shot firer toget in a safe place around a corner;

2. Short-circuited at the battery end until ready to attach to the blastingunit;

3. Staggered as to length or the ends kept well separated when attached tothe detonator leg wires; and

4. Kept clear of power wires and all other possible sources of active orstray electric currents.

(Code 1950, § 45-53.6; 1954, c. 191; 1966, c. 594, § 45.1-49; 1994, c. 28.)
